My Project
Every year my district does a district wide science fair. One requirement is for students to have a lab notebook. I would like to be able to provide these notebooks for my students.
Keeping a laboratory notebook is a key skill to develop and have as a scientist.
I want to be able to teach my students this important skill. I want my students to have a place to keep all of their research, thoughts, trials and errors for their science fair project in one place. By learning how to keep a laboratory notebook for an experiment now, they will hone skills they will need for high school and college.
